1. Define Portage and Porter County coverage precisely

A local page should state what your firm actually serves. Portage is a city in Porter County, Indiana; those geographic facts do not establish that every Porter County resident is a prospective client or that every Portage search has legal intent. Your review should distinguish Portage city pages from countywide coverage, Indiana-wide services, and any other places your firm intentionally serves. That distinction matters because an AI system needs to understand who you are, what you practice, and where you work. 2. Match pages to the questions legal clients ask

People often describe a legal problem rather than use a precise legal-service keyword. Bosseo describes answer-ready content built around real client questions and a clear, quotable structure. For a Portage firm, the review should connect each approved practice area to questions relevant to the firm’s actual work and Indiana jurisdiction. A city reference alone is not enough: a useful page must explain the service accurately, identify the applicable geographic scope, and make clear when a consultation is appropriate. Google’s guidance says scaled pages need original value, accuracy, and relevance.

Recommended approach

Evaluate whether each important page answers one defined client question, uses the firm’s own accurate information, and avoids unsupported legal conclusions. Prioritize clarity over producing many near-identical city pages.

5. Decide what measurement would count as useful

A visibility change is not the same as a qualified consultation, retained matter, or revenue. Bosseo’s public product page lists an ROI Dashboard and Lead Attribution among its broader services, and describes tracking AI citations alongside rankings, leads, and calls. Whether those services fit your firm should be confirmed directly. Your decision should define the business signals you can actually recognize and review, such as source information provided by a caller or intake record.

Recommended approach

Agree on definitions before implementation: what counts as a qualified inquiry, how a source is recorded, and which outcomes the firm can review. Do not treat Portage’s population, a ranking position, or an AI mention as a substitute for matter-quality analysis.
